12/06/2009 - College PREP - Cedar Hill, TX Garrett is a solid C with strong tools. Most of his tools showed true in Cedar Hill, and his 60 time dropped from 8.08 to 7.94. Garrett has good footwork behind the plate, he stays low, and come out of the shoot quickly. His hands are soft, and his throws are online with life and carry to them. His arm strength is definitely a plus. His pop times have been as low as 1.97 and if Garrett can work on a shorter arm action, pop times could become even lower. Offensively, Garrett has good balance, bat speed, and rhythm. He is an aggressive hitter and does a nice job keeping his head and eyes on the baseball. Garrett's offensive numbers could further improve with a proper load and more extension through the baseball.

02/08/2009 - College PREP - Houston, TX Garrett continues to show steady improvement in his baseball abilities. Pop times dropped as indicated by his 2.09 low pop time with pop times being more consistent in the 2.18 range. He has polished up his footwork and transfer but needs to stay low coming out to throw. Pop times will continue to drop if he gets on a strict long toss program to further aid in developing more arm strength and carry on throws. Blocking skills have improved the most, now showing well above average. He shows off his athletic ability through the blocking process in getting his body down around the baseball showing proper angles. He moves well laterally and will keep the ball in front. At the plate, abilities are solid average with slightly average power. Hands are direct and he utilizes his lower half. Hitting grades will improve quickly with instruction and adjustments at the plate.

08/23/2008 - ACR-E - California - 3 Lewis has a tall lean frame that will be able to hold added muscle as he matures. He has improved several things since we last saw him. Once he fills out he will improve overall body control. Gains ground when throwing and footwork is direct. He will quicken pop times if he shortens stride, quickens exchange, and eliminates wrist flip on the backside. Showed some athleticism blocking, quick down, but needs to spread legs and get some spine angle. Also keep hands down. He showed the best at the plate. Short to the ball, balance, quiet load, and gets some extension. He can improve the lower half. Overall strength will improve his entire game.

Tool Grade Scale

Our main goals with the BF "10-70" Scouting Scale are to provide the player with a realistic evaluation of his "PRESENT" abilities (what he can do today), and to provide college coaches with information they can use to identify and/or compare potential recruits.

Tools are graded for all players and pitchers, regardless of age or graduation year. However, for High School players we use only grades 20-70 (grades 10-18 do not apply), while for Middle School players we use only grades 10-52 (grades 55-70 do not apply).
